Transaction 57fd0ab17fd3f4211173c2b98a6250184a0bf3b0ab31438230a84f79fef72f63

94 Input
2 Outputs
  • 57fd0ab17fd3f4211173c2b98a6250184a0bf3b0ab31438230a84f79fef72f63:0
  • value  720184
    address  37MD97HVi2gZgsMkr2LDzNgXcnxuw6S5Kv
  • 57fd0ab17fd3f4211173c2b98a6250184a0bf3b0ab31438230a84f79fef72f63:1
  • value  6818691244
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s